About this opportunity

Doodle for Google is an annual celebration of student art and creativity. Each year, K-12 students dream up their interpretations of a creative theme, competing to display their artwork on the Google homepage. For 2025-26, the theme is "My superpower is..." Students submit artistic interpretations incorporating the Google logo letters, evaluated on artistic merit, creativity, and theme communication. The national winner receives Google.com recognition, Google technology, and merchandise.

What you'll do

  • Create an artistic doodle interpreting the contest theme 'My superpower is...'
  • Incorporate the Google logo letters into your artwork design
  • Write a description explaining your interpretation of the theme
  • Compete for national recognition with artwork displayed on Google homepage
  • Have your work evaluated on artistic merit, creativity, and theme communication
